



Sports injury is very common and almost expected as part of the daily occurrences or mishaps to an athlete. Whenever the player sustains an injury to the eye or areas near the eye, it is usually very severe in nature. Most contact sports may cause eye injuries that are in the form of a corneal abrasion from a finger poked to the eye. There can also be a potential for a detached retina from a sharp blow to the head area by a shoulder, elbow, or ball traveling at high velocity. Here the trauma to the eye is not only painful, but can also be very sight-threatening.
